03 2016 档案

摘要:maven出现后,很多公司会用maven来构建项目,单仅仅只是单项目单工程的 并没有使用多工程来构建,这样在以后,项目越来越大,业务越来越多以后,项目会难以维护,越发庞大,维护成本提高,团队士气也会下降 等等情况,使用maven构建多工程就是如今的趋势 这边演示一个maven工程相互依赖的例子,高手 阅读全文
posted @ 2016-03-31 00:24 风间影月 阅读(4289) 评论(0) 推荐(4) 编辑
摘要:原文转载:http://blog.jobbole.com/99123/ 先介绍一下作者 DHH,他是 Ruby on Rails 作者。Basecamp 创始人&CTO。《重来》(rework)作者 缺乏睡眠就像是借高利贷。确实你会多得到几个小时做你以为几个小时就能做完的工作,但是代价是什么?你迟早 阅读全文
posted @ 2016-03-30 09:29 风间影月 阅读(573) 评论(2) 推荐(0) 编辑
摘要:原文地址:http://www.infoq.com/cn/articles/flash-deal-architecture-optimization 一、秒杀业务为什么难做 IM系统,例如QQ或者微博,每个人都读自己的数据(好友列表、群列表、个人信息)。 微博系统,每个人读你关注的人的数据,一个人读 阅读全文
posted @ 2016-03-29 17:57 风间影月 阅读(603) 评论(0) 推荐(0) 编辑
摘要:我个人比较喜欢写注释,在工作中对注释的重要性看的也比较高,所以大部分文字都在注释中,代码外的文字会写的偏少,关键能懂就行 先看一下整合后的工程目录(单工程,多工程以后会采用maven) 5个package分别对应 action, entity, mapper(也就是DAO,采用动态代理), serv 阅读全文
posted @ 2016-03-28 14:35 风间影月 阅读(2071) 评论(1) 推荐(3) 编辑
摘要:WHAT – 什么是微服务 微服务简介 这次参加JavaOne2015最大的困难就是听Microservice相关的session,无论内容多么水,只要题目带microservice,必定报不上名,可见Microservice有多火。最喜欢其中一页。关于这个典故,可以参考this,此图适用于一切高大 阅读全文
posted @ 2016-03-28 09:25 风间影月 阅读(566) 评论(0) 推荐(0) 编辑
摘要:最近看了nginx以及tomcat的集群,通俗的做一下简单总结吧 nginx 是一个http服务器,是由俄罗斯人发明的,目前主流的服务器,作为负载均衡服务器,性能非常好,最高支持5万个并发连接数,在淘宝被广泛使用(据说被淘宝的工程师优化到单机200万的并发,非常的厉害) 单个tomcat最大支持的用 阅读全文
posted @ 2016-03-27 22:17 风间影月 阅读(2993) 评论(1) 推荐(1) 编辑
摘要:db.properties SqlMapConfig.xml OrderMapper.xml OrderMapper.java Items.java Orderdetail.java Orders.java OrdersCustom.java OrderUserCustom.java User.ja 阅读全文
posted @ 2016-03-23 16:25 风间影月 阅读(2683) 评论(0) 推荐(0) 编辑
摘要:db.properties 单独提取出来的数据库配置,方便以后维护管理 SqlMapConfig.xml UserMapper.java UserMapper.xml QueryVo.java User.java UserCustom.java 最后附上github地址:https://github 阅读全文
posted @ 2016-03-22 15:47 风间影月 阅读(361) 评论(0) 推荐(0) 编辑
摘要:原文转载于http://blog.jobbole.com/98877/ 我是一个 iPhone 独立开发者,已经坚持每天工作三小时两年了。这个方法可能不适合每一个人,但是我从2014年初就开始培养这个习惯了。我坚持这么做是因为发现这是我最高效的工作方式。 我这种工作方式的灵感来自于我在创业课程中看的 阅读全文
posted @ 2016-03-22 15:37 风间影月 阅读(612) 评论(0) 推荐(0) 编辑
摘要:mybatis呢是一个orm数据库框架,非常适合新人学,门槛相对较低 本人呢曾经是先做的hibernate,后接触的mybatis,接触mabatis前我比较抵触,为啥呢, 当时喜欢hibernate的POJO,直接注解实体映射数据库表对象,要增删改造直接get(id),save(entity),d 阅读全文
posted @ 2016-03-22 15:24 风间影月 阅读(525) 评论(0) 推荐(1) 编辑
摘要:在现在很多业务场景(比如聊天室),又或者是手机端的一些online游戏,都需要做到实时通信,那怎么来进行双向通信呢,总不见得用曾经很破旧的ajax每隔10秒或者每隔20秒来请求吧,我的天呐(),这尼玛太坑了 跟webservice来相比,Web Socket可以做到保持长连接,或者说强连接,一直握手 阅读全文
posted @ 2016-03-22 14:33 风间影月 阅读(2738) 评论(0) 推荐(0) 编辑
摘要:先贴出POM的内容,这个毕竟是用的maven来简单构建的 关于AOP的配置,我个人还是喜欢用XML来配置,一来方便管理,看的清楚,一个项目的aop也不会太多,二来注解形式的不好管理 applicationContext.xml的话只要有2行就行 ITeacherDAO.java TeacherDAO 阅读全文
posted @ 2016-03-22 13:54 风间影月 阅读(473) 评论(0) 推荐(1) 编辑
摘要:AOP在spring中是非常重要的一个 在切面类中,有5种通知类型: aop:before 前置通知 aop:after-returning 后置通知 aop:after 最终通知 aop:after-throwing 异常通知 aop:around 环绕通知 关于切面的表达式简单说一下: IPer 阅读全文
posted @ 2016-03-22 13:37 风间影月 阅读(380) 评论(0) 推荐(0) 编辑
摘要:IStuDAO.java IStuService.java PersonAction.java StuDAOImpl.java StuServiceImpl.java 测试 github地址:https://github.com/leechenxiang/maven-spring001-hellow 阅读全文
posted @ 2016-03-22 11:59 风间影月 阅读(326) 评论(0) 推荐(0) 编辑
摘要:之前的文章大多都是一带而过,一方面比较简单,一方面不是用的注解形式 在企业开发中,主要还是使用的注解来进行开发的 主要还是用 @Resource,另外2个不常用 测试: github地址:https://github.com/leechenxiang/maven-spring001-hellowor 阅读全文
posted @ 2016-03-22 11:49 风间影月 阅读(461) 评论(2) 推荐(0) 编辑
摘要:IStuDAO.java IStuService.java PersonAction.java StuDAOImpl.java StuServiceImpl.java 测试: github地址:https://github.com/leechenxiang/maven-spring001-hello 阅读全文
posted @ 2016-03-22 11:19 风间影月 阅读(476) 评论(0) 推荐(1) 编辑
摘要:github地址:https://github.com/leechenxiang/maven-spring001-helloworld 阅读全文
posted @ 2016-03-22 11:06 风间影月 阅读(319) 评论(0) 推荐(0) 编辑
摘要:spring bean配置后再默认情况下是单例的,如果需要配置可以选择 prototype, request, session和global session 在配置spring mvc的action时,可以对action使用 prototype bean的创建销毁过程: 测试: github地址:h 阅读全文
posted @ 2016-03-22 11:02 风间影月 阅读(479) 评论(0) 推荐(0) 编辑
摘要:别名就是可以通过另外一个名字来访问如下,已有bean:helloWorld3,那么定义别名(alias )后,就能使用“abc”来访问 github地址:https://github.com/leechenxiang/maven-spring001-helloworld 阅读全文
posted @ 2016-03-22 10:54 风间影月 阅读(348) 评论(0) 推荐(0) 编辑
摘要:静态工厂方法及实例工厂的使用: applicationContext.xml: HelloWorldFactory.java HelloWorldFactory2.java 测试: github地址:https://github.com/leechenxiang/maven-spring001-he 阅读全文
posted @ 2016-03-22 10:50 风间影月 阅读(317) 评论(0) 推荐(0) 编辑
摘要:简单介绍一下spring,一方面带新手入入门,一方面自己也重温一下第一个小工厂先暂时不用maven,下一个会用maven来来配置 jar包只需要一个,spring版本为2.5(暂时为2.5,后续更新,基本核心都是一样的),引入spring.jar到lib,如下: 在src下新建application 阅读全文
posted @ 2016-03-22 10:34 风间影月 阅读(369) 评论(0) 推荐(0) 编辑
摘要:其实一直都在使用常用工具类,只是从没去整理过,今天空了把一些常用的整理一下吧 怎么使用的一看就明白,另外还有注释,最后的使用pom引入的jar包 附上地址:https://github.com/leechenxiang/maven-apache-commons 阅读全文
posted @ 2016-03-17 17:09 风间影月 阅读(6301) 评论(0) 推荐(0) 编辑
摘要:昨天发现单位里的eclipse中的maven直接不显示了,不能在 Windows-Preference 中显示maven 也不能新建maven工程,也不能maven-update,连STS(Spring tool suite) 也不起作用 一开始以为下载了SVN冲突了,单位的工程是没有使用maven 阅读全文
posted @ 2016-03-16 09:11 风间影月 阅读(393)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示